Transaction 21670d6f1590625b9e37a05eee1b89eb059c3864cc9f9f663e5ce2123b37f215

1 Input
2 Outputs
  • 21670d6f1590625b9e37a05eee1b89eb059c3864cc9f9f663e5ce2123b37f215:0
  • value  1382877001
    address  12PzYmRRgKadwr4bWT2YTufKLQjGWPfvjr
  • 21670d6f1590625b9e37a05eee1b89eb059c3864cc9f9f663e5ce2123b37f215:1
  • value  13200000
    address  3Fxx65NyjVgEWyd1pmhQQVwYQWcLY9SAt7